let arrs = Array();
arrs[0] = "a";
arrs[1] = "b";
arrs[2] = "c";
for(let m=0;m<arrs.length;m++){
console.log(arrs[m]);
}
console.log("------------使用pop()------------");
let deletealphabet = arrs.pop();
console.log("删除的元素"+deletealphabet);
for(let m=0;m<arrs.length;m++){
console.log(arrs[m]);
}
console.log("这里就说明了,pop()是删除数组里面的最后一个元素,并且将他返回");
console.log("------------使用push()------------");
let pop_return = arrs.push("m");
console.log("新数组的长度"+pop_return)
for(let m=0;m<arrs.length;m++){
console.log(arrs[m]);
}
console.log("这里说明push是将元素添加到数组的尾部,并且返回新数组的长度");
console.log("------------使用reverse------------");
let newarrs = arrs.reverse();
for(let m=0;m<arrs.length;m++){
console.log(newarrs[m]);
}
console.log("------------从上面的例子中我们可以发现reverse是将数据倒叙------------");
console.log("------------使用unshift------------");
let number = arrs.unshift("ll","hah");
console.log("新数组的长度"+number);
for(let m=0;m<arrs.length;m++){
console.log(arrs[m]);
}
console.log("unshift是将元素添加到数组的开头,可以添加多个元素,并且番薯新数组的长度")
console.log("------------使用splice------------");
let fruits = ["Banana", "Orange", "Apple", "Mango"];
let return_result = fruits.splice(2,2,"Lemon","Kiwi");
console.log(return_result);
for(let m=0;m<fruits.length;m++){
console.log(fruits[m]);
}
console.log("------------使用shift------------");
let fruits2 = ["Banana", "Orange", "Apple", "Mango"];
let unshift_return = fruits2.shift();
for(let m=0;m<unshift_return.length;m++){
console.log(unshift_return[m]);
}
console.log("------------使用concat------------");
let fruits3 = ["Banana", "Orange", "Apple", "Mango"];
let fruits4 = ["Banana2", "Orange2", "Apple2", "Mango2"];
let return_concat = fruits3.concat(fruits4);
console.log(return_concat);
for(let m=0;m<return_concat.length;m++){
console.log(return_concat[m]);
}
console.log("------------使用slice------------");
let fruits5 = ["Banana", "Orange", "Apple", "Mango"];
let new_fruits5 = fruits5.slice(0);
console.log(new_fruits5)
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 分享4款.NET开源、免费、实用的商城系统
· 全程不用写代码,我用AI程序员写了一个飞机大战
· MongoDB 8.0这个新功能碉堡了,比商业数据库还牛
· 白话解读 Dapr 1.15:你的「微服务管家」又秀新绝活了
· 上周热点回顾(2.24-3.2)